Subject: TileForge cache layer — shipped

Team,

The new tile-rendering cache layer is live on the Orrery cluster. Warm hits now skip rasterization entirely; cold misses fall back to the old path. Eviction is LRU, capped at 40 GB per node. If render latency regresses, flip the `cache_bypass` flag and page whoever owns Orrery that week. Config notes are in the Lantern wiki. The deploy trace is below.

pipeline stamp: htk9_ce63042d9

This PR reworks the Tallbridge fleet fuel-usage report to aggregate per-depot rather than per-vehicle, fixing the double-counting seen in the Ashgrove rollout. All figures were cross-checked against last quarter's manual audit. Please review the smoothing and outlier thresholds carefully, as they directly affect the published numbers.

constants for fawep-yagap:
QUOTAS = {
    "noveth": 275,
    "oliion": 740,
}

## Provenance: the stale-cache saga

Quick recap for whoever touches the Brindlework build cache next. The postmortem found that cache keys ignored the toolchain version, so a compiler bump served stale objects for two days. We now hash the full toolchain manifest into every key. If you ever suspect stale artifacts, compare manifests before blaming the code. The fixed pipeline's first clean run carried the token below.

trace token, fafog-kageg: htk4_98e6

MEMO: Retirement of the Ashvale Sensor Line

To the incoming director: effective end of Q2, we are discontinuing the Ashvale sensor family. Demand has shifted to the Petrel series, and component sourcing for Ashvale is no longer economical. Support continues for existing contracts through year-end. Manufacturing capacity in the Norwick plant will be reallocated. Customer communications go out next month; the migration team reports to you. Broader context for this decision appears in the confidential note below.

internal memo for yahag-hahig: Belwynix Group plans to lower the Silir list price by 62 percent in May.